您现在的位置是: 网站首页> 精品案例 NVM 管理 Node.js 版本常用命令手册
NVM 管理 Node.js 版本常用命令手册
若谷
2025-09-14
928 人已围观
【演示URL:】
简介NVM 管理 Node.js 版本常用命令手册
NVM 管理 Node.js 版本常用命令手册
NVM(Node Version Manager)是一款轻量级工具,能帮你在电脑上同时安装多个 Node.js 版本,随时切换不同版本适配项目需求,以下是最常用的操作命令:
一、安装 Node.js 版本相关命令
1. 安装最新稳定版 Node.js
nvm install latest |
说明:自动下载并安装当前 Node.js 官网的最新稳定版本,适合需要尝鲜新功能的场景。
2. 安装指定版本 Node.js
nvm install 18.17.0 # 示例:安装18.17.0版本 |
说明:
• 版本号需准确(可通过nvm ls-remote查看可安装的版本);
• 若需要安装长期支持版(LTS,更稳定,适合生产环境),可加--lts后缀:
nvm install 18.17.0 --lts # 安装18.17.0的LTS版 |
3. 安装最新 LTS 版本 Node.js
nvm install --lts |
说明:直接安装当前最新的 LTS 版本,无需手动指定版本号,适合大多数项目开发。
二、版本切换与验证命令
1. 切换到已安装的指定版本
nvm use 18.17.0 # 示例:切换到18.17.0版本 |
说明:切换后,当前终端窗口会使用该版本的 Node.js;若需所有终端默认使用,需设置 “默认版本”(见下方命令)。
2. 设置默认 Node.js 版本
nvm alias default 18.17.0 # 示例:将18.17.0设为默认版本 |
说明:设置后,每次打开新终端,都会自动使用这个默认版本,无需重复切换。
3. 验证当前使用的版本
# 查看当前Node.js版本 node -v # 查看当前npm版本(npm随Node.js一起安装) npm -v |
说明:执行node -v后,若显示的版本号与你切换的版本一致,说明切换成功。
三、查看版本信息命令
1. 查看本地已安装的所有 Node.js 版本
nvm ls |
说明:列表中会用*标记当前正在使用的版本,用default标记默认版本,清晰区分已安装版本。
2. 查看远程可安装的 Node.js 版本
nvm ls-remote |
说明:列出 Node.js 官网所有可安装的版本(包括稳定版、LTS 版),方便你选择需要安装的版本号。
3. 查看当前使用的 Node.js 版本(简洁版)
nvm current |
说明:直接输出当前终端正在使用的 Node.js 版本号,比node -v更聚焦于 NVM 的版本管理视角。
四、卸载 Node.js 版本命令
nvm uninstall 18.17.0 # 示例:卸载18.17.0版本 |
说明:
• 只能卸载通过 NVM 安装的 Node.js 版本;
• 卸载前建议先通过nvm ls确认该版本已安装,且不再需要(避免误删常用版本)。
五、其他常用辅助命令
1. 查看 NVM 自身版本
nvm version |
说明:确认当前 NVM 的版本,若版本过旧可能存在兼容性问题,可通过官方文档更新 NVM。
2. 列出所有 NVM 命令(帮助手册)
nvm help |
说明:若忘记某个命令,可执行此命令查看完整的 NVM 命令列表及详细说明。
小贴士
1. Windows 系统注意:Windows 系统需使用 “nvm-windows”(与 Linux/macOS 的 NVM 命令基本一致,仅安装方式不同);
2. 切换版本后生效范围:nvm use仅对当前终端生效,若要全局生效,务必用nvm alias default设置默认版本;
3. 版本选择建议:开发新项目时优先选 LTS 版本(如 18.x、20.x),兼容性更强;维护旧项目时,需切换到项目依赖的 Node.js 版本(可查看项目的package.json或文档)。
上一篇:创建的mysql数据库,root是只允许localhost访问的,下面需要配置允许所有IP,都能访问。
下一篇:没有下一篇了!
相关文章
-
NVM 管理 Node.js 版本常用命令手册 NVM 管理 Node.js 版本常用命令手册 文章阅读